听听6鈥7 p.m.听听听Richard Jessor Building, Room 155
Efforts to return cultural artifacts to descendant communities are reshaping how archaeology is practiced. This raises new legal, ethical and collaborative questions for researchers working in the U.S. and abroad. This public panel hosted by the Center for Collaborative Synthesis in Archaeology and the Institute of Behavioral Science will explore how repatriation, Indigenous sovereignty and heritage law are redefining the field.

The听Big Ideas initiative听is a campuswide effort to surface and amplify transformational ideas that could shape the university鈥檚 impact for decades to come. 麻豆免费版下载Boulder students, staff and faculty are invited to join in these interactive sessions designed to spark cross-disciplinary conversation and generate new ideas through small-group dialogue. Modeled after a 鈥淲orld Caf茅鈥 format, participants will rotate through themed tables, build on each other鈥檚 thinking and explore bold possibilities for 麻豆免费版下载Boulder鈥檚 future.听
